Page 1 sur 3
[Résolu] m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 09:59
par poluket
Salut mika,
je viens de mettre a jour le plugin et le deamon ne démarre plus:
version de la mise a jour: 2019-07-25 01:19:22
Log du plugin:
Code : Tout sélectionner
[2019-07-25 09:55:02][INFO] : [Start] e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=0.0.0 -D -T -S --listen-tcp=6720 -b iptn:192.168.3.210:3671 >> /var/log/knx.log 2>&1 &
[2019-07-25 09:55:03][DEBUG] : Lancement du Bus Monitor
[2019-07-25 09:55:03][DEBUG] : Connexion a EIBD sur le serveur 127.0.0.1:6720
[2019-07-25 09:55:03][ERROR] : Erreur sur eibd::BusMonitor() : connect failed
[2019-07-25 09:55:04][DEBUG] : Initialisation de valeur des objets KNX
[2019-07-25 09:55:04][ERROR] : Erreur sur la fonction deamon_start du plugin : connect failed
dans le fichier knx.log, je n'ai que ceci:
je test une réinstallation des dépendances
Re: m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 10:03
par poluket
la reinstallation des dependances n'a pas aidé
quand je fait un netstat -tupln, le deamon eibd n'écoute pas:
Code : Tout sélectionner
(Not all processes could be identified, non-owned process info
will not be shown, you would have to be root to see it all.)
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address Foreign Address State PID/Program name
tcp 0 0 127.0.0.1:3306 0.0.0.0:* LISTEN -
tcp 0 0 127.0.0.1:8083 0.0.0.0:* LISTEN 2182/python
tcp 0 0 0.0.0.0:22 0.0.0.0:* LISTEN -
tcp 0 0 192.168.3.197:8121 0.0.0.0:* LISTEN 2013/nodejs
tcp 0 0 127.0.0.1:25 0.0.0.0:* LISTEN -
tcp 0 0 0.0.0.0:1883 0.0.0.0:* LISTEN -
tcp 0 0 127.0.0.1:55010 0.0.0.0:* LISTEN 2073/python
tcp 0 0 0.0.0.0:10050 0.0.0.0:* LISTEN -
tcp6 0 0 :::80 :::* LISTEN -
tcp6 0 0 :::22 :::* LISTEN -
tcp6 0 0 ::1:25 :::* LISTEN -
tcp6 0 0 :::1883 :::* LISTEN -
tcp6 0 0 :::443 :::* LISTEN -
tcp6 0 0 :::10050 :::* LISTEN -
udp 0 0 192.168.3.197:123 0.0.0.0:* -
udp 0 0 127.0.0.1:123 0.0.0.0:* -
udp 0 0 0.0.0.0:123 0.0.0.0:* -
udp6 0 0 fe80::3082:31ff:fef:123 :::* -
udp6 0 0 ::1:123 :::* -
udp6 0 0 :::123 :::* -
Re: m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 10:05
par poluket
je crois avoir trouvé, il y a une faute dans la commande pour demarrer le deamon
cela devrait etre ceci :
Code : Tout sélectionner
e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=0.0.0 -D -T -S --listen-tcp=6720 iptn:192.168.3.210:3671
plutot que ceci :
Code : Tout sélectionner
e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=0.0.0 -D -T -S --listen-tcp=6720 -b iptn:192.168.3.210:3671
il y a un
"-b " en trop pour moi
je viens de tester en modifiant le fichier
/plugins/eibd/core/class/eibd.class.php et cela fonctionne de nouveau
modif faite a la ligne 702 (ajout des "//") :
Code : Tout sélectionner
701 $cmd .= ' --listen-tcp='.config::byKey('EibdPort', 'eibd');
702 //$cmd .= ' -b ';
703 if($cmd != ''){
Re: m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 11:20
par mika-nt28
Effectivement ce paramètre est exclusivement pour knxd.
La correction est sur le market
Re: m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 11:33
par poluket
mise a jour testée, c'est bon pour moi,
merci,
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 14:51
par simnetsa
Alors pour moi les soucis sont apparus juste après la MàJ de 11h12.
J'ai désactivé la gestion automatique du démon, relancé l'installation des dépendances, réactivé la gestion automatique et c'est reparti.
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 25 juil. 2019, 16:00
par mika-nt28
Oui le bug dont parle @poluket a ete corrigé sur la mise a jours dont tu parle
Dans cette mise a jours le plugin ne lance plus le demon en route mais il faut donné les droit soit en reinstallant le dependance soit en ssh avec cette commande
sudo chmod 777 /usr/local/bin/eibd
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 29 juil. 2019, 12:01
par poluket
Code : Tout sélectionner
[2019-07-29 11:50:03][INFO] : [Start] e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=0.0.0 -D -T -S --listen-tcp=6720 iptn:192.168.3.210:3671 >> /var/log/knx.log 2>&1 &
[2019-07-29 11:50:03][DEBUG] : Lancement du Bus Monitor
[2019-07-29 11:50:03][DEBUG] : Connexion a EIBD sur le serveur 127.0.0.1:6720
[2019-07-29 11:50:03][ERROR] : Erreur sur eibd::BusMonitor() : connect failed
[2019-07-29 11:50:05][DEBUG] : Initialisation de valeur des objets KNX
[2019-07-29 11:50:05][ERROR] : Erreur sur la fonction deamon_start du plugin : connect failed
[2019-07-29 11:53:00][INFO] : [Start] e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=0.0.0 -D -T -S --listen-tcp=6720 iptn:192.168.3.210:3671 >> /var/log/knx.log 2>&1
[2019-07-29 11:53:00][DEBUG] : Lancement du Bus Monitor
[2019-07-29 11:53:00][DEBUG] : Connexion a EIBD sur le serveur 127.0.0.1:6720
[2019-07-29 11:53:02][DEBUG] : Initialisation de valeur des objets KNX
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 14 août 2019, 14:09
par bendangers
Bonjour,
Je rencontre le même problème
Je suis avec une passerelle Ethernet Siemens
Code : Tout sélectionner
[2019-08-14 11:46:34][INFO] : [Start] eibd --daemon=/var/log/knx.log --pid-file=/var/run/knx.pid -t1023 --eibaddr=1.1.1 -D -T -S --listen-tcp=6720 ipt:192.168.0.5 >> /var/log/knx.log
[2019-08-14 11:46:35][DEBUG] : Lancement du Bus Monitor
[2019-08-14 11:46:35][DEBUG] : Connexion a EIBD sur le serveur 127.0.0.1:6720
[2019-08-14 11:46:35][ERROR] : Erreur sur eibd::BusMonitor() : connect failed
[2019-08-14 11:46:36][DEBUG] : Initialisation de valeur des objets KNX
[2019-08-14 11:46:36][ERROR] : Erreur sur la fonction deamon_start du plugin : connect failed
J'ai bien fait la commande en SSH :
Egalement Réinstallé les dépendances
Mais toujours rien
Si vous avez une autre idée
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 août 2019, 22:05
par poluket
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 17 sept. 2019, 19:34
par minipouch
Bonjour,
Systématiquement que je mets à jour le plugin, je dois recommencer la manœuvre du workaround.
N'est-il pas envisageable de l'intégrer directement dans le plugin?
Merci
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 17 sept. 2019, 20:42
par poluket
chez moi, je ne fais plus la manip du workaroud, je n'ai plus de problème de démarrage du deamon.
cela ne va toujours pas chez toi?
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 09:03
par mika-nt28
Le sudo en debut de lancement a ete supprimé par des raison de securité si tu as des problème systématique c'est que tu n'a pas réinstaller les depndance ou que tu est sur USB et que tu n'a pas donné les droit a jeedom sur le port
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 09:42
par minipouch
mika-nt28 a écrit :Le sudo en debut de lancement a ete supprimé par des raison de securité si tu as des problème systématique c'est que tu n'a pas réinstaller les depndance ou que tu est sur USB et que tu n'a pas donné les droit a jeedom sur le port
Bonjour,
A mon avis, mon problème est cité dans ton commentaire.
J’ai réinstallé les dépendances. Sans succès.
Comme tu supposais, je suis en usb et je n’ai probablement pas donné les droits à jeedom.
Tu sais me dire comment faire ?
En te remerciant
Envoyé de mon iPad en utilisant Tapatalk
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 09:44
par mika-nt28
Pour donné les droit sur le port USB j'avais posté se tuto
viewtopic.php?f=49&t=47216
Je l'avais mis dans le core mais cela provoquais visiblement un changement d'adresse du port donc bien faire une recherche après
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 09:58
par minipouch
mika-nt28 a écrit :Pour donné les droit sur le port USB j'avais posté se tuto
viewtopic.php?f=49&t=47216
Je l'avais mis dans le core mais cela provoquais visiblement un changement d'adresse du port donc bien faire une recherche après
Je viens de voir ton post et j’ai lu le tuto qui m’a l’air nébuleux pour un néophyte comme moi. Surtout la partie « noter et remplacer... »
J’imagine que la commande chmod 777... se fait après le notâge et remplacement...
Bref, je suis au boulot là et j’essaierai en rentrant tantôt mais je ne suis pas sûr de bien comprendre.
Envoyé de mon iPad en utilisant Tapatalk
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 10:15
par mika-nt28
Oui c'est pas evidant et ecore moin a expliqué (du moins je n'ai pas se talent)
On peux le faire ensemble
Qu'obtient tu lorsque tu fait un lsusb
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 11:21
par minipouch
mika-nt28 a écrit :Oui c'est pas evidant et ecore moin a expliqué (du moins je n'ai pas se talent)
On peux le faire ensemble
Qu'obtient tu lorsque tu fait un lsusb
C’est super gentil de ta part.
Comme dit plus haut, je suis au travail et n’ai pas accès à mon jeedom. Du moins en ssh.
Ce soir vers 19h, ça irait pour toi ?
Merci d’avance
Envoyé de mon iPad en utilisant Tapatalk
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 21:48
par minipouch
mika-nt28 a écrit : ↑18 sept. 2019, 10:15
Oui c'est pas evidant et ecore moin a expliqué (du moins je n'ai pas se talent)
On peux le faire ensemble
Qu'obtient tu lorsque tu fait un lsusb
Bonsoir,
Désolé, je rentre seulement et c'est plus tard que prévu.
Alors effectivement, je ne comprend pas la manière de faire.
Quand je fais lsusb, j'ai ca:
Bus 001 Device 006: ID 174c:55aa ASMedia Technology Inc. ASM1051E SATA 6Gb/s bridge, ASM1053E SATA 6Gb/s bridge, ASM1153 SATA 3Gb/s bridge
Bus 001 Device 004: ID 135e:0025
Bus 001 Device 005: ID 0424:7800 Standard Microsystems Corp.
Bus 001 Device 003: ID 0424:2514 Standard Microsystems Corp. USB 2.0 Hub
Bus 001 Device 002: ID 0424:2514 Standard Microsystems Corp. USB 2.0 Hub
Bus 001 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Ahhhhh, en relisant ton tuto, je me demande si je ne viens pas de comprendre ce que je dois faire...
Je te dis ce que j'ai compris:
Dans la commande: sudo chmod 777 /dev/bus/usb/Bus/Device
Je dois remplacer "Bus/Device" par "001/006" ou "Bus 001/Device 006"
Autrement dit: sudo chmod 777 /dev/bus/usb/001/006
ou
sudo chmod 777 /dev/bus/usb/Bus 001/Device 006
Tu sais me dire laquelle des 2 solutions est la bonne?
Deuxième question, d'après toi, c'est quoi ma passerelle USB?
Troisième question, la commande: sudo chmod 777 /dev/bus/usb/Bus/Device doit se faire directement à la racine de jeedom? Autrement dit dès que j’accède à mon jeedom en ssh?
En te remerciant
Re: [Résolu] mise a jour - problème demarrage deamon
Publié : 18 sept. 2019, 21:51
par poluket
c'est bien cela: sudo chmod 777 /dev/bus/usb/001/004
ta passerelle n'est pas en 6 pour moi. si tu clic sur rechercher, tu as quoi? 1:4:1:0:0
et oui, des que tu es en ssh , c'est bon